About us

Belka Games is a game developer operating since 2010, one of the fastest growing companies in the industry with offices in several cities and countries. We take a data-driven and team-oriented approach, which has enabled the company to keep growing in both audience and product metrics. We handle all sides of the game development and marketing process: from creating and testing prototypes to LiveOps and analytics. We are focused on creating games with high ARPU and solid D28 retention metrics. Clockmaker, Bermuda Adventured and Solitaire Cruise are 3 top grossing projects of the company with >1 mln users playing daily. Several new titles, including midcore one, are gearing up to outrank our super grossing projects. Juicy, catchy graphics and technical quality are key to success of the projects in the audience.

  • On June 25, our Head of Localization, Denis Ivanov, will be speaking at Game Quality Forum about how we automated the conversion from Simplified to Traditional Chinese using AI. He’ll cover: 🔸 Defining requirements and goals for the automated conversion process 🔸 Research phase: dataset selection, prompt engineering, and optimization 🔸 Integrating AI into the CMS for seamless workflow automation 🔸 Testing and validation to ensure linguistic and contextual accuracy 🔸 Implementing and monitoring the AI-powered automation in a live production environment If you’re attending the conference too—don’t miss it!
